【ca证书的解释】在数字安全日益重要的今天,CA证书(Certificate Authority Certificate)作为保障网络通信安全的重要工具,被广泛应用于网站加密、电子邮件认证、身份验证等多个领域。本文将对CA证书的基本概念、作用及常见类型进行简要总结,并通过表格形式清晰展示其关键信息。
一、CA证书的基本概念
CA证书是由可信的第三方机构(即证书颁发机构,Certificate Authority, CA)签发的一种数字证书。它用于验证某个实体(如网站、个人或组织)的身份,并确保其在网络通信中使用的公钥是合法且可信的。CA证书的核心作用在于建立信任链,防止中间人攻击和数据篡改。
二、CA证书的主要功能
功能 | 说明 |
身份验证 | 确认证书持有者的身份真实性 |
数据加密 | 通过公钥加密技术保护数据传输安全 |
防止篡改 | 通过数字签名确保数据完整性 |
建立信任 | 在浏览器或系统中自动识别可信来源 |
三、CA证书的常见类型
类型 | 用途 | 特点 |
服务器证书 | 用于HTTPS加密网站 | 需绑定域名,由CA机构审核 |
客户端证书 | 用于用户身份认证 | 常用于企业内部系统或高安全性环境 |
代码签名证书 | 用于软件或程序签名 | 保证软件来源可靠,防止恶意篡改 |
电子邮件证书 | 用于加密和签名邮件 | 提升电子邮件通信的安全性 |
四、CA证书的工作原理
1. 申请与审核:用户向CA提交申请并提供相关身份证明材料。
2. 生成密钥对:用户生成公钥和私钥,其中私钥由用户保存,公钥提交给CA。
3. 证书签发:CA使用自己的私钥对用户的公钥和相关信息进行签名,生成CA证书。
4. 证书部署:用户将证书安装在服务器或设备上,供客户端验证。
5. 验证过程:当客户端访问受保护资源时,会检查证书是否有效、是否由可信CA签发。
五、常见的CA机构
CA机构 | 国家/地区 | 备注 |
DigiCert | 美国 | 全球知名,支持多种证书类型 |
Let's Encrypt | 美国 | 免费证书,广泛用于开源项目 |
GlobalSign | 欧洲 | 提供高安全性解决方案 |
WoT (Web of Trust) | 国际 | 基于用户互信的去中心化模型 |
六、CA证书的重要性
随着网络安全威胁不断升级,CA证书已成为现代互联网基础设施的重要组成部分。它不仅保障了数据传输的安全性,还提升了用户对在线服务的信任度。无论是企业网站、移动应用还是电子政务平台,合理使用CA证书都是提升整体安全性的关键步骤。
通过以上内容可以看出,CA证书不仅是技术工具,更是构建数字信任体系的基础。选择合适的CA机构、正确配置证书,能够有效降低网络风险,保障信息安全。